RESUMO

Microcirculation has great importance in eye and testicular tissue and is necessary to have adequate and appropriate amount of angiogenesis. It is known that high levels of Vascular Endothelial Growth Factor (VEGF) trigger uncontrolled angiogenesis, whereas inadequate VEGF can lead to decreased tissue perfusion and oxygenation. The aim of this study was to investigate effects of VEGF in testicular and ocular tissues in both non-diabetic and diabetic rats treated by statin. Atorvastatin (10 mg/kg daily given by orally gavage) was administered for two weeks. Diabetes was induced by streptozotocin, (STZ, 45 mg/kg/ip) in diabetic group's rats. Two weeks later from STZ injection, atorvastatin treatment was initiated in diabetic group. VEGF levels were measured by using ELISA. The VEGF levels were decreased in vitrous, ocular and testicular tissues of all statin-administered rats. In diabetic group VEGF levels were found to be decreased in testicular tissue and increased in ocular tissues. CONCLUSION: Statin use decreased in VEGF levels of testicular and ocular tissues in diabetic and non-diabetic rats. Statin treatment (anti-VEGF effect) had a protective effect in the development of diabetic retinopathy, yet statins may have a negative impact on tissues that depend on microcirculation by reducing VEGF levels. Further research is needed for statins' microcellular effects.

RESUMO

To characterize current treatment practices, we compared the use of atypical antipsychotic drugs among women of childbearing age to men based on electronic medical records of 1073 hospital-based psychiatric outpatients given at least one second-generation antipsychotic drug. One quarter of psychiatric outpatients sampled were prescribed at least one atypical antipsychotic, in more than half of cases for off-label indications. Women were significantly more likely than men to be diagnosed with mood or anxiety disorders than psychotic disorders and to be prescribed quetiapine (60.7 vs. 48.0 %) or aripiprazole (31.2 vs. 23.9 %), but less likely risperidone (15.8 vs. 26.1 %) or ziprasidone (10 vs. 14 %).

RESUMO

BACKGROUND: Delirium commonly occurs in hospitalized elderly patients, resulting in increased morbidity and mortality. Although evidence for treatment of delirium exists, evidence supporting pharmacologic prevention of delirium in high risk patients is limited. OBJECTIVE: This review examined whether delirium in at-risk patients can be prevented with antipsychotic prophylaxis in the inpatient setting. DATA SOURCES: A systematic literature review of articles from January 1950 to April 2012 was conducted in PubMed, PsychInfo, and Cochrane Controlled Trials and databases. STUDY SELECTION: Five studies (1491 participants) met our inclusion criteria for analysis. Medication administered included haloperidol (three studies), risperidone (one study), and olanzapine (1 study). All five studies examined older post-surgical patients, spanning five different countries. DATA EXTRACTION: Only RCTs of antipsychotic medication used to prevent delirium were included. Key words used in the search were: "delirium," "encephalopathy," "ICU psychosis," "prevention," and "prophylaxis." Studies had to include a validated method of diagnosing delirium. Data analysis was performed using the Metan command in Stata (Stata Corp LP, College Station, TX). RESULTS: The pooled relative risk of the five studies resulted in a 50% reduction in the relative risk of delirium among those receiving antipsychotic medication compared with placebo (RR(95% CI): 0.51 (0.33-0.79; heterogeneity, p < 0.01, random effects model). Examination of the funnel plot did not indicate publication bias. CONCLUSIONS: Although few studies have examined prophylactic use of antipsychotics, this analysis suggests that perioperative use of prophylactic antipsychotics may effectively reduce the overall risk of postoperative delirium in elderly patients.

RESUMO

Recruitment in psychiatry has been an ongoing challenge worldwide; Turkey is no exception. In this article we have reviewed the issue from multiple aspects. Negative opinions on psychiatry among medical students have been associated with various matters, such as problems with scientific soundness, stigma, prestige and financial incentives. It has been reported that these negative opinions could be reversed by clinical exposure, improved knowledge base and increased affiliation with the field. Unfortunately, reversed attitudes do not have permanency. Considering that there has not been any study focusing on recruitment problems in Turkey, we attempted to provide a perspective by reporting the results of our study conducted with Turkish medical students. Attractive qualities of psychiatry were of particular interest. We found that brain research, neuroscience, philosophy, psychotherapy and academics are main areas of interest in psychiatry. We attempt to discuss our findings in view of current literature while noting current setbacks of psychiatry residency training in Turkey. We conclude that there exists a great need for working strategies in order to improve recruitment in psychiatry, addressing the stigma and correcting false beliefs such as treatment inefficacy or compromised scientific solidity.

RESUMO

Empathy is a multidimensional paradigm, and there currently is a lack of scientific consensus in its definition. In this paper, we review the possibility of compromising data during behavioral neuroscience experiments, including but not limited to those who study empathy. The experimental protocols can affect, and be affected by, empathy and related processes at multiple levels. We discuss several points to help researchers develop a successful translational pathway for behavioral research on empathy. Despite varying in their focus with no widely accepted model, current rodent models on empathy have provided sound translational explanations for many neuropsychiatric proof-of-concepts to date. Research has shown that empathy can be influenced by many parameters, some of which are to be reviewed in this paper. We emphasize the future importance of consistency in modeling proof of concept; efforts to create a multidisciplinary group which would include both bench scientists and clinicians with expertise in neuropsychiatry, and the consideration of empathy as an independent variable in animal behavioral experimental designs which is not the mainstream practice at present.

RESUMO

OBJECTIVES: Acute mania is a serious medical condition that impacts men and women equally. Longtime presentation of manic symptoms is sex-dependent; however, little is known about acute symptoms of mania. The objective of this study is to track and compare acute manic symptoms for sex differences during inpatient hospitalization. METHODS: All patients with bipolar mania admitted to a large university hospital between January and October 2017 were invited to participate in this longitudinal naturalistic follow-up study. Manic (YMRS), depressive (MADRS), and psychotic (PAS) symptoms were tracked daily from admission to discharge. RESULTS: The total YMRS scores decreased significantly overtime (p < .0001) in both male (n = 34) and female (n = 23) patients (p = .7). However, male patients scored significantly higher in sexual interest (p = .01), disruptive and aggressive behavior (p = .01), and appearance (p < .001) while females had better insight into their illness (p = .01). Males and females received similar doses of lithium (p = .1), but males received significantly higher doses of valproic acid (VPA) in comparison with females (p = .003). However, plasma lithium and VPA concentrations at discharge were not significantly different between sexes. CONCLUSION: Our results show sex differences in the progression of certain domains of manic symptoms in a cohort of 23 female and 34 male patients admitted to a large academic center in Turkey. Males, in this sample, exhibited more sexual interest, disruptive and aggressive behaviors, better grooming, and less insight compared to females. While these results are concordant with our preclinical findings and with anecdotal clinical observations, replication in larger samples is needed.

RESUMO

OBJECTIVE: Valproic acid (VPA)-induced hyperammonemia (VIH), is an increase in blood ammonia levels without any alteration of hepatic enzymes, which can occur during VPA treatment. We aimed to determine the prevalence rate and the risk factors for VIH and its association with cognitive functions. METHOD: A prospective, cross-sectional study was conducted. Patients aged between 18 and 64 who were on VPA treatment and who diagnosed with mood disorders or epilepsy were enrolled in this study (n = 107). For cognitive assessment, Serial 7's and Subjective Memory Complaints Questionnaire (SMCQ) were used. Blood samples were collected for blood VPA and ammonia levels along with other laboratory tests. RESULTS: 55,3% of the sample were considered as VIH. Blood ammonia level significantly correlates with VPA blood levels, total daily dose of VPA and total number of medications concurrently used, but no significant correlation was found between blood ammonia level and cognitive test scores. Gender, body weight, blood VPA levels and the total number of medications concurrently used significantly predicted blood ammonia levels (F(4,81) = 2670, p = 0,038, R2 = 0,116). CONCLUSION: VIH is relatively high in our sample. There is a dose-dependent association between VPA and blood ammonia level. No association was found between cognitive functions and hyperammonemia however with some limitations. Future, prospective cohort studies are needed.

RESUMO

Magnesium is an element of great importance functioning because of its association with many cellular physiological functions. The magnesium content of foods is gradually decreasing due to food processing, and magnesium supplementation for healthy living has become increasingly popular. However, data is very limited on the bioavailability of various magnesium preparations. The aim of this study is to investigate the bioavailability of five different magnesium compounds (magnesium sulfate, magnesium oxide, magnesium acetyl taurate, magnesium citrate, and magnesium malate) in different tissues. Following a single dose 400 mg/70 kg magnesium administration to Sprague Dawley rats, bioavailability was evaluated by examining time-dependent absorption, tissue penetration, and the effects on the behavior of the animals. Pharmacokinetically, the area under the curve calculation is highest in the magnesium malate. The magnesium acetyl taurate was found to have the second highest area under the curve calculation. Magnesium acetyl taurate was rapidly absorbed, able to pass through to the brain easily, had the highest tissue concentration level in the brain, and was found to be associated with decreased anxiety indicators. Magnesium malate levels remained high for an extended period of time in the serum. The commonly prescribed dietary supplements magnesium oxide and magnesium citrate had the lowest bioavailability when compared to our control group. More research is needed to investigate the bioavailability of magnesium malate and acetyl taurate compounds and their effects in specific tissues and on behavior.

RESUMO

Empathy defined as the ability to understand and the share the feelings, thoughts, and attitudes of another, is an important skill in survival and reproduction. Among many factors that affect empathy include psychological stress, anxiety states. The aim of this study was to investigate the impact of acute psychological stress on empathic behavior and its association with oxytocin and vasopressin levels in amygdala and prefrontal cortex. Rats were subjected to 0.2 mA (low) and 1.6 mA (high) intensity of foot shock stress for duration of 20 min. Empathic behavior was found to be improved as a response to low intensity stress, but not to high intensity stress. As a response to lower intensity stress, vasopressin was increased in prefrontal cortex and amygdala; oxytocin was increased in only prefrontal cortex, and corticosterone levels increased in general. Anxiety indicators did not change in low intensity stress group yet; high intensity stress group demonstrated a lesser degree of anxiety response. High intensity stress group stayed unexpectedly more active in middle area of elevated plus maze test equipment, which may support impaired executive decision making abilities in the setting of high anxiety states. Further research is needed to investigate gender effects, the role of dopaminergic system and other stress related pathways in acute stress.

RESUMO

Empathy is the ability to recognize, process and respond to another's emotional state and empathic functions have been linked with a multitude of cognitive and affective processes. Impaired empathy has been linked to aggression and criminal behavior in society. Acetaminophen (paracetamol) is among the most common nonprescription (over the counter) analgesics in the world and has been already linked to reducing empathic behavior in humans. The aim of this study is to investigate the effects of acetaminophen on empathy-like behavior in Sprague Dawley rats, and we further explored the underlying mechanisms by analyzing empathy related neurohormones, e.g. oxytocin and vasopressin, in association with acetaminophen exposure in rats. Empathic behavior was assessed 30 min following acetaminophen administration (100, 200, and 400 mg/kg). The impact of single and repeated acetaminophen administrations on empathy-like behavior and anxiety level were evaluated separately. Empathy-like behavior was reduced with a single high dose of acetaminophen. Subsequent low dose administration of acetaminophen also reduced empathy-like behavior. In this study we also showed that acetaminophen decreased oxytocin and vasopressin levels in the prefrontal cortex and amygdalae. We found a negative correlation between delay in door opening time and measured prefrontal cortex oxytocin levels; we adjudged the latency in door opening time as enhanced empathic behavior which seemingly suggested the existence of a mechanism between empathy-like behavior and the prefrontal oxytocin. We observed that both a single high dose or repeated low dose administrations of acetaminophen reduced empathy-like behavior in correlation with a decrease in oxytocin and vasopressin levels in the prefrontal cortex and amygdala. Further research is needed to investigate the role of acetaminophen on the other empathic brain pathways.

RESUMO

Background  An active intravenous substance use disorder is often the primary cause of infectious diseases in this population of users and creates a barrier to successful parenteral antimicrobial management. The dilemma is compounded by dramatically limited resources in small US towns. Methods This retrospective review from January 2014 through July 2016 aimed to develop a risk stratification approach to aid rural healthcare providers in determining who among patients with addictive disorders could safely be discharged for outpatient antimicrobial therapy with a peripherally inserted central catheter (PICC). Results The high-risk group had a greater likelihood of noncompliance with antimicrobial therapy completion, as well as subsequent illicit drug use during that time frame, compared with the moderate- and low-risk groups. The low-risk group and most of the moderate-risk group could be safely discharged into the community with PICC lines. Conclusions Key in the risk stratification proposal was identifying risk behaviors and determining their degree. Such information provides pivotal delineators in developing risk stratification criteria.

RESUMO

We report a case of an intravenous drug user (IVDU) patient who had 4 episodes of endocarditis within a 2-year time period in rural Georgia. The institutional cost was approximately $380,000. The lack of an established transitional care plan for IVDUs to outpatient care is a common phenomenon at institutions. Guidelines are essential to optimize the quality of care rendered to IVDUs with such infections, to assist providers in utilizing limited resources, and to limit the cost to the institutions.

RESUMO

It is known that regular aerobic exercise has positive effects on hippocampus and prefrontal cortex. We have previously have been able to demonstrate that aerobic exercise increased IGF-1 in hippocampus. Leptin, which is associated with cognitive functions, is also involved in fat metabolism and stimulates energy consumption. While it is known that leptin stimulates IGF-1 production in hepatocytes, little known is on the link between IGF-1 and leptin in brain during aerobic exercise. In this study, we investigated the effects of regular aerobic exercise on leptin, leptin receptor expression levels in hippocampus and prefrontal cortex. Additionally, we investigated the correlation of IGF-1 levels with leptin and leptin receptor expression. During the experiment, exercise group was run on a treadmill for 30min per session at a speed of 8m/min and 0° slope, five times a week for 6 weeks. Leptin, leptin expression, IGF-1 levels and cell numbers increased in prefrontal cortex and hippocampus of exercise groups. Blood leptin levels increased in female rats in exercise group; whereas it did not change in male rats; blood IGF-1 levels were found to be increased in exercised male rats. There was a strong positive correlation between hippocampal leptin levels and hippocampal IGF-1 levels; also a strong positive correlation between hippocampal leptin receptor expression and hippocampal IGF-1. These results indicate that, increased leptin and leptin receptor expression are correlated with IGF-1 in regular aerobic exercised rats. Blood leptin and IGF-1 levels were also found to be associated with gender. Females had high blood leptin levels and males had high blood IGF-1 levels in the exercise groups.

RESUMO

Alcohol withdrawal syndrome (AWS) is a potentially fatal outcome of severe alcohol dependence that presents a significant challenge to treatment. Although AWS is thought to be driven by a hyperglutamatergic brain state, benzodiazepines, which target the GABAergic system, comprise the first line of treatment for AWS. Using a rat model of ethanol withdrawal, we tested whether ceftriaxone, a ß-lactam antibiotic known to increase the expression and activity of glutamate uptake transporter EAAT2, reduces the occurrence or severity of ethanol withdrawal manifestations. After a 2-week period of habituation to ethanol in two-bottle choice, alcohol-preferring (P) and Wistar rats received ethanol (4.0 g/kg) every 6 h for 3-5 consecutive days via gavage. Rats were then deprived of ethanol for 48 h during which time they received ceftriaxone (50 or 100 mg/kg, IP) or saline twice a day starting 12 h after the last ethanol administration. Withdrawal manifestations were captured by continuous video recording and coded. The evolution of ethanol withdrawal was markedly different for P rats vs Wistar rats, with withdrawal manifestations occurring >12 h later in P rats than in Wistar rats. Ceftriaxone 100 mg/kg per injection twice per day (200 mg/kg/day) reduced or abolished all manifestations of ethanol withdrawal in both rat variants and prevented withdrawal-induced escalation of alcohol intake. Finally, ceftriaxone treatment was associated with lasting upregulation of ethanol withdrawal-induced downregulation of EAAT2 in the striatum. Our data support the role of ceftriaxone in alleviating alcohol withdrawal and open a novel pharmacologic avenue that requires clinical evaluation in patients with AWS.

RESUMO

BACKGROUND: It is well known that diabetes mellitus may cause testicular damage. Vascular endothelial growth factor (VEGF) and nerve growth factor beta (NGF-ß) are important neurotrophic factors for male reproductive system. OBJECTIVE: We aimed to investigate the correlation between testicular damage and testicular VEGF and NGF-ß levels in diabetic rats. METHODS: Diabetes was induced by streptozotocin (STZ, 45 mg/kg/i.p.) in adult rats. Five weeks later testicular tissue was removed; testicular VEGF and NGF-ß levels were measured by ELISA. Testicular damage was detected by using hematoxylin and eosin staining and periodic acid-Schiff staining, and apoptosis was identified by terminal-deoxynucleotidyl-transferase-mediated dUTP nick end labeling (TUNEL). Seminiferous tubular sperm formation was evaluated using Johnsen's score. RESULTS: In diabetic rats, seminiferous tubule diameter was found to be decreased; basement membrane was found to be thickened in seminiferous tubules and degenerated germ cells. Additionally, TUNEL-positive cells were increased in number of VEGF+ cells and levels of VEGF and NGF-ß were decreased in diabetic testes. Correlation between VEGF and NGF-ß levels was strong. CONCLUSION: These results suggest that the decrease of VEGF and NGF-ß levels is associated with the increase of the apoptosis and testicular damage in diabetic rats. Testis VEGF and NGF-ß levels could be potential novel biomarkers for diabetes induced testicular damage.

RESUMO

The lateral hypothalamus integrates critical physiological functions such as the sleep-wake cycle, energy expenditure, and sexual behaviors. These functions are severely dysregulated during mania. In this study, we successfully induced manic-like behavioral phenotypes in adult, male Wistar rats through bilateral lateral hypothalamic area kindling (LHK). To test the validity of the model, we studied the effect of standard antimanic medications lithium (47.5 mg/kg) or valproic acid (200 mg/kg) twice/day for 15 days in attenuating manic-like behaviors in the LHK rat. Compared with pre-kindling behaviors, LHK rats displayed significantly increased sexual self-stimulation (P = 0.034), excessive rearing (P = 0.0005), feeding (P = 0.013), and grooming (P = 0.007) during the kindling interval. LHK rats also drank more alcohol during the mania-induction days compared with baseline ethanol consumption levels (P = 0.01). Moreover, LHK rat exhibited increased total locomotor activity (P = 0.02) with reduced rest interval (P < 0.001) during the mania induction and post-mania days compared with baseline activity levels and rest intervals. Chronic administration of lithium or valproic acid significantly attenuated manic-like behaviors in the LHK rat model. Given the behavioral phenotype and the response to standard antimanic medications, the LHK rats may provide a model for studying manic psychopathology in humans.

RESUMO

It is already known that regular aerobic exercise during adolescent period improves learning and memory in rats. In this study, we investigated the effects of regular aerobic exercise on learning, memory functioning and IGF-1 levels. IGF-1 is known to have positive effects on cognitive functions in adolescent rats. Exercise group was separated into two different groups. First half was run on a treadmill for 30 min per session at a speed of 8m/min and 0° slope, five times a week for 6 weeks. The second half was given free access to a running wheel (diameter 11.5 cm) which was connected to a digital counter and run on a treadmill for 6 weeks. Learning and memory functioning were found to be positively correlated with the exercise activity. Findings suggest increased neuron density in CA1 hippocampal region and dentate gyrus. Increased IGF-1 level was detected in hippocampus and blood serum, while IGF-1 level in liver tissue did not change with exercise activity. In conclusion, our findings indicate that learning and memory functioning were positively affected by voluntary and involuntary physical exercise which correlated increased hippocampal activity and elevated IGF-1 levels in adolescent rats.
